>> I once got caught up in the whole counterpoise issue.  I have a zero
>> three antenna and I have 60 40' #14 stranded THHN lowes copper wire at dirt
>> level.  IF you can elevate them then yes you can do the tuned radials thing
>> (which I might add can be a PITN...literally if you clothes line yourself)
>> but not actually needed.  Why 60 radials?  thats all the holes my DX
>> engineering mounting plate had.  I could have doubled up to 120 radials but
>> I felt it wasnt necessary.  Yeah I could have gone and done some modeling
>> etc but I wanted to get on the air.  and 60 40' radials is a fair amount of
>> wire to measure, cut, crimp, solder, wash, rinse, repeat!  Also, funny
>> thing about elevated radials is you really cant use that area for any kind
>> of recreation, dog walking etc without disturbing them.  bummer...

>>> > I think the answer is "it depends"!  Conventional wisdom has it that
>>> the
>>> > length of the radials are not as critical when on the ground or buried.
>>> > Ground conductivity gets into the act here also. Things would be quite
>>> > different in Arizona!
>>> >
>>> >  In your case the 8.6 foot radial is a "tuned" radial and should be in
>>> the
>>> > same plane as the antenna, although not critical if it hangs vertically
>>> > (although it may affect the directionality somewhat.  In the case of
>>> the 80
>>> > meter radial, again it should be elevated to function as a tuned
>>> radial,
>>> > but if your situation calls for it to be on the ground, the elevation
>>> of
>>> > the feedpoint should not be added to the radial length, as it is all
>>> part
>>> > of the radial length.  Since part of the counterpoise is on the
>>> ground, it
>>> > will become detuned by the earth anyway.  There are several treatises
>>> in
>>> > the ARRL archives concerning grounds, radials, and counterpoises.
>>> >
>>> > FYI, I have a ground  mounted vertical antenna and I simply have 32,
>>> > twenty-five foot radials on the ground or slightly buried.  This works
>>> very
>>> > well.  When I had this antenna mounted on a tile roof in EA7 land, I
>>> used 4
>>> > elevated,  stub-tuned radials which worked very well. Adding additional
>>> > radials on the roof did not make any noticeable difference.

>>> > If I need a 65 to 70 foot counterpoise for 80 Meters and a 8.6 foot
>>> one for
>>> > 10  Meters and my balun from my end-fed antenna is 10 foot up do I
>>> need to
>>> > add 10 feet to the math to get the counterpoise to ground level for it
>>> to
>>> > be effective. In the example of 10 meters the wire is just hanging in
>>> air.
>>> > These would be run opposite to the feedline. Thanks!
